La Plata Canyon offers a moderate fall hiking experience, with trails that wind through aspen groves and along the La Plata River. The route is approximately 2 hours in duration, and hikers can expect to encounter some elevation gain and variable trail conditions, including potential snow and ice at higher elevations later in the season. From September through November, the canyon's aspen trees turn golden, creating a striking backdrop for a hike. Visitors will find amenities such as parking and restrooms available, and the area is pet-friendly, making it a suitable destination for those hiking with dogs.
